Well, this is not the first time or the first executive president who was a diabolic liar who duped the public with false promises. The first is J.R who they believed would give them 8 pounds of grain. Instead he changed the existing constitution expecting to carry on forever and created this mess. J.R introduced the Executive Presidency and also changed the UNP constitution likewise. But unfortunately with all his shrewdness he did not realize that Ranil unlike the late Lalith Atulathmudali or Gamini Dissanayake is not capable nor has he the credibility to manage both the country and the party.

Second is Ms Chandrika Kumaratunga who made an attempt to change the constitution acceptable by all, but failed due to the greed or shortsightedness of the UNP as well as her own party people. However, she stepped down to give way to the demands of the SLFP seniors to nominate Mahinda Rajapaksa. Pity she could have done a good job, if honesty prevailed with better advisers to guide her.

Thirdly is the current President who thanks to Srimavo Bandaranaike and of course to his late mother who taught him to be honest, decent and truthful and who requested Ms Bandaranaike to make him a member of the parliament.  But never in their wildest dreams had they expected him to swindle the people of the nation.

The general public had great hopes since he was coming from a respected family being a cousin of great politician George Rajapaksa. George Rajapaksa was an honest man with integrity.  He was never a greedy man but spent his own money to serve the people.
